By constructing a type of antisymmetric matrix Lie algebra, a way to generate enlarging integrable systems is presented. The such integrable hierarchies are not integrable couplings, specially, their corresponding Hamiltonian structure can be obtained by the trace identity. As an application example, the enlarging integrable system and the Hamiltonian structure of the AKNS hierarchy are given. Finally, the explicit relations expressed by the formulae among the solutions of the stationary zero curvature equations are obtained.
